    The Story Behind Marie-Antonia

    Marie-Antonia is a double-barreled name, combining two classic female names: Marie and Antonia. Marie is the French form of Maria, which has a complex etymology, often linked to the Hebrew 'Miryam' (meaning 'bitter' or 'rebellious'), but also interpreted as 'star of the sea' (Stella Maris) from Latin, or even derived from an ancient Egyptian name meaning 'beloved'. Antonia is the feminine form of Antonius, an ancient Roman family name of Etruscan origin, meaning 'priceless' or 'flourishing'. The combination gained prominence through historical figures, most notably Marie Antoinette, though her name was spelled differently, the sound and components are very similar, contributing to the regal and classic feel of Marie-Antonia.
